Science Still Has a Lot to Learn From Star Trek
News from the BBC today that researchers have developed a new model of time travel that uses quantum mechanics to explain one of the more difficult paradoxes of time travel - that if we were to travel back in time we might disturb the past, which might change the present.
The new view seems to be - er, well - you can’t change the past - that’s why they call it the “past”.
Is there more to this than smart-alecky physicists, trying to see whether we’ve been paying attention to Star Trek (which taught us that we can change the past - just as long as we change it back before we return)???
